When you adjust the screws does it change the normal and sport control or feel, like out of the box?
Yes, it's going to change the feel for those modes as well, but you will still not be able to flip the drone upside down in those modes. They retain their safety mechanisms.
Only now, you do need to be slightly more mindful of the fact that you cannot just let go of the throttle stick in a panic and expect it to center itself.
I actually everyone comfortable on sticks should just use it this way because it's much more relaxing and makes sense to not have a throttle that is constantly flighting you on an FPV drone like this.

I tried to land in manual, hit the landing a little hard, it started bouncing like crazy, flipped upside down and I couldn’t shut the damn motors off! Happen to anyone else?
Yes. Always just flip to normal mode and land that way. I've had this happen as well. The 'little hard' landing causes the flight controller to freak out, and it's very sensitive.
